New industry initiative establishes an open category for data architectures that power real-time applications and AI agents

SUNNYVALE, September 15, 2026: Aiven, Confluent, Redpanda, StreamNative and Ververica today announced the formation of the Streamhouse Working Group and published an open, vendor-neutral definition of Streamhouse, a data architecture designed to keep the current state of a business continuously available to production applications, analytics, and AI agents.

Under a binding trademark commitment published with the definition, the Streamhouse name will be free for the industry to use without permission or fees.

A Shared Data Architecture for the Age of AI

Organizations are beginning to deploy applications and AI agents that do more than analyze what happened in the past: they make decisions and take action as business events unfold. To act reliably, these systems need fresh, governed business context delivered continuously and at production service levels.

The business context these applications and agents need is distributed across databases, applications, cloud services, and analytical systems. The challenge is making that context available wherever it is needed, with the freshness, governance, and reliability that production use requires.

The five founding companies approach this challenge from different technological perspectives. They formed the Streamhouse Working Group because they see organizations converging on a common architectural pattern. Streaming technologies are foundational to that pattern, but no single project, component, or vendor portfolio constitutes a Streamhouse on its own.

Defining the Streamhouse Architecture

A Streamhouse architecture enables organizations to capture, transport, transform, govern, and serve the current state of their business continuously so that production applications, analytics, and AI agents can act on it.

The architecture is defined by three attributes:

  • Real-time: Data remains continuously current as business events occur rather than being refreshed only through periodic batch processes.
  • Production-native: The architecture is engineered to production service levels because business-critical applications, analytics, and agents depend on it continuously.
  • Decentralized: It meets data where it already lives rather than requiring all enterprise data to be consolidated into a single system first.

Change data capture, event streams, stream processing, open table formats, catalogs, and low-latency serving exemplify this approach. Organizations can build a Streamhouse with open-source technologies, commercial products, or both.

Lakehouse architectures expanded the ability to store and analyze large volumes of historical data for business intelligence. A Streamhouse is designed to help applications and agents run the business as events happen. These two architectures coexist in many of the world's leading organizations, each serving their intended workloads and exchanging data through open formats.

Advancing an Open Category

The Streamhouse Working Group will:

  • Maintain and evolve the Streamhouse definition publicly through a versioned repository.
  • Advance the technologies, open standards, and interoperability practices needed to build Streamhouse architectures.
  • Encourage participation from customers, practitioners, technology providers, and the broader data community.
  • Preserve Streamhouse as an open, vendor-neutral category that no single company controls.

"Applications and agents increasingly need fresh, governed data as events happen," the five founding members said in a joint statement. "An open definition gives the industry shared language for this architecture and a common starting point for advancing the technologies and standards behind it."

Keeping Streamhouse Open

The Streamhouse name was coined by Ververica. Under the trademark commitment published with this announcement, anyone may use Streamhouse to describe, discuss, implement, market, or analyze architectures consistent with the open definition without permission, notice, registration, or fees.

The complete definition is maintained in a public GitHub repository and available through streamhouse.com/definition. The trademark commitment is available at streamhouse.com/trademark.

About StreamNative

StreamNative, the data streaming company, offers a high-performance, cost-efficient data streaming platform powered by Ursa Engine, supporting mission-critical operational business applications, AI, and analytics workloads. Built on a leaderless, lakehouse-native architecture, StreamNative eliminates the inefficiencies of traditional systems like Kafka, enabling enterprises to operate at 5% of the cost while unifying streaming and batch data in open formats such as Apache Iceberg and Delta Lake. Trusted by global enterprises and fast-growing unicorns, StreamNative offers unmatched flexibility with Serverless, Dedicated, BYOC (Bring Your Own Cloud), and Private Cloud deployment options—all backed by a 99.95% SLA and 24/7 expert support. Recognized as a Leader in the 2024 GigaOm Radar Report for Streaming Data Platforms, StreamNative ensures real-time data flows with zero operational overhead, empowering organizations to transform raw data into AI-ready insights at unprecedented speed and scale.
